Re: Website Avatar
In the forum, avatars are deactivated. But you can add an avatar to your jira profile (jira.reactos.org) This is where you can report bugs and errors too (to answer your question of another thread).
I would like to point you to the wiki, many things regarding testing and debugging are there more or less excellent described.
Also about how to write API tests, to point out the root of your found bugs.
For instant answers to questions you should join freenode irc channel #reactos or #reactos-dev.
Most devs are there and try to help if they can.
